Soak your hair in the warm … WebBroadly speaking wax is a flammable, carbon-containing solid that becomes liquid when heated above room temperature. In other words it’s the candle’s fuel. When the scented candle is lit, the wax melts, is vaporised and combusted, which in turn produces the heat and light. WebDec 28, 2014 · tommykat1 said: I use paraffin wax on my bearing edges. It's the kind of wax used for making preserves and jelly. Somebody--a drum expert, can't remember who--advised me to use it to help seat the head and make tuning easier. I'm really not sure it makes any difference, but I continue to do it out of habit.
